Chavez Backs Mel

Hugo Chávez has stated that “The revolutionary governments of the region are not going to stay with their arms crossed during an intent to overthrow Zelaya”. “We are disposed to do what we have to do to respect the sovereignty of Honduras and the wishes of the Honduran people”, said Chávez, after revealing that he has talked about the situation in Honduras with his colleagues from Bolivia and Nicaragua. Morales, Ortega, and Fidel Castro, ex-president of Cuba, all announced their support for Zelaya.

Toncontin Airport was closed for a time in order that no Venezuelan charter flights could land, but reopened later.
